Event record message regarding Virtual CD Security service
Error message i.e. Mismatch in drives number found in regkey
(1) and sytem(0)
The event log entry indicates that Virtual CD has found one Virtual CD-ROM drive, but there is no (virtual CD ROM) drive in the system. This may be a timing problem and can be ignored if everything else is working.
Background information:
The number of virtual CD-ROM drives is stored in the REG-DWORD value NumberofCDRoms. If you get this error message, this number does not match the number of drives found in the device manager. This value can be found under
Virtual CD v4 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\vcdmpdrv\
Virtual CD v5 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\vbev5mp\. If you want to see and change this value, start regedt32. Give the logged in user full access to the key vbev5mp using "Security -> Permissions". When done please remove the full access permissions.
Virtual CD v6 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\obvious.ini\
Virtual CD v7 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\vdrv7000.ini\
Virtual CD v8 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\vdrv8000.ini\
Virtual CD v9 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\vdrv9000.ini\
Virtual CD v10 in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\vdrv1000.ini\
